Job Summary

Part-time applicants will be considered for this role.

The Group Capital Regulatory Reporting (GCRR) is responsible for the production, control and delivery of the Group's key prudential supervisory reporting and disclosure for Capital, Large Exposures and Leverage, including: COREP (Own Funds, LE, Leverage) and Pillar 3, as well as the relevant parts of the Annual Report, Interim Management Statements and Interim announcements.

The team is based in London and supported by teams in India, Poland and Singapore. The team also plays a key support and liaison role for country regulatory teams, global functions (such as Risk, Compliance and Treasury), Investor Relations and is a key contact for the Bank of England. The team also acts as a centre of subject matter expertise in internal assessment of new regulations for the business, delivering Quantitative Impact studies, supporting change functions and Financial Planning and Analytics, advising senior management, regulatory liaison, participating in industry groups, and supporting external stakeholders.

GCRR team has responsibility for reporting/disclosure requirements including COREP own funds, leverage, large exposures and Pillar 3. This is delivered by a team of ~ 12 in the UK and ~90 located in Chennai Bangalore and Poland. The team works closely with the Group Financial Reporting team and are key stakeholders in the quarterly disclosure process. The GCRR team designs and operates the control framework, identifies and raises change requests for Finance Change to action and perform user acceptance testing.

This role of Manager - Group Capital Regulatory Reporting reports to the Regulatory Reporting Senior Manager covering various aspects of BAU capital reporting team covering the Credit Risk, Counterparty Risk, CVA, Securitisation, Leverage and Large Exposure parts of the COREP returns and associated disclosures, GSIB, QIS and Pillar 2.

Key Responsibilities

Strategy


* Work with the Regulatory Reporting Senior Manager to report to the PRA financial and risk information for Common Reporting (COREP)) and other reporting deliverables.
* Responsibility for external market regulatory reporting (Results Announcement, Pillar 3 Disclosures etc), ad hoc regulatory submissions and the provision of internal advice and guidance on regulatory reporting.
* Contribute to the development and implementation of regulatory projects to deliver a best in class and sustainable regulatory reporting utility for the future.

Business

* Understanding of the Group's businesses and products and how they impact regulatory capital metrics, reporting and associated controls.
* Expertise in relation to the regulatory capital calculations (particularly credit risk including counterparty credit risk (standardised and models) and securitisations) including current and future rules and regulations and how they apply to SCB.
* Expertise in systems and processes used to generate regulatory capital metrics.
* Interpretation and guidance to business units on PRA rules under Basel 3.1 and taxonomy changes.

Processes

* Timely submission of GCRR processes covering COREP Own funds, Large Exposures, Securitisation, Leverage, Pillar 2, G-SIB and associated reporting and disclosure.
* Development and maintenance of controls and the control environment
* Extensive use of Excel, and SQL for data extraction and analysis.
* Review key variances, trends and commentaries for RWAs, Leverage and Large Exposures.
* Maintain a list of system/process/data issues and contribute to Capital Data Quality Forum.
* Develop solutions to mitigate risk associated with systems/process/data issues and streamline.
* Take the lead on Moody's Risk Authority and Axiom User Acceptance Testing & Signoffs for system updates and new software releases.
* Assist with ad-hoc queries relating to capital and regulatory reporting
* Contribute to the bank's responses on Discussion and Consultation papers and Technical Standards on regulatory developments and changes from the Basel Committee, PRA and others.

People & Talent

* No line management responsibilities
* Establish strong working relationships with the team across geographical locations, technology and the Risk, Credit Policy and Model Governance teams.
* Liaise with Regulatory Reporting Policy on matters of interpretation and changes to PRA rules under Basel 3.1
* Provide subject matter expertise on COREP reporting to PRA.
* Build a strong working relationship with the external auditors and the regulators.

Risk Management

* Execute under the relevant Operational Risk Framework processes - Group Capital Regulatory Reporting.
* Ensure a full understanding of the risk and control environment in area of responsibility to identify control gaps in the end-to-end regulatory reporting process within Finance.
* Design or amend and implement suitable controls across the suite of regulatory capital metrics reported by Financial Regulatory Reporting.

Governance

* Responsible for design and execution of BAU control framework including relevant policies and standards, and monitoring of controls.
